When comparing smartwatches for seniors, there are several beneficial features to look for. These include readability, health monitoring, battery life, and safety features like fall detection, emergency SOS buttons, and GPS location tracking.
Features to look for with a smartwatch for seniors
Large, High-Contrast Display
Readability is vital in a smartwatch for seniors. A big screen with bright, large, easy-to-read text is essential for visibility, especially in varying lighting conditions.
Intuitive User Interface
Simple navigation, large icons, straightforward menus, and an option for voice commands will make the use of the watch much easier for those who may be less technologically inclined.
Fall Detection
Safety first. Many smartwatches offer an automatic fall detection feature that will alert contacts and/or emergency services if a fall is detected.
Emergency SOS
Quick access to an Emergency SOS feature that allows the wearer to quickly and easily call for help in an emergency.
GPS Tracking
The built-in GPS in a smartwatch enables location tracking, making it easy for contacts or emergency services to quickly pinpoint the location of the wearer during an emergency event.
Health Monitoring
Continuous heart rate monitoring, blood oxygen level tracking, sleep tracking, ECG tracking, and even Medical ID integration help the wearer monitor and manage their health and fitness.
Long Battery Life
A lengthy battery-life means less charging and more wearing, which is helpful for the senior who is taking advantage of the watch’s many other features.
Voice Assistant and Commands
The use of a voice assistant to operate the watch and access its features can be helpful to anyone, but especially to a senior who may experience dexterity challenges or struggle to navigate a complex menu or small buttons.
Water Resistance
Water-resistant design means the watch can be worn throughout daily activities, including showering, which can be beneficial in the event of health event.
Connectivity
The ability to make and receive calls and send and receive messages keeps the wearer connected to family and friends, offering an added sense of security and independence.

One More Consideration: Compatibility
One more thing to consider when smartwatch shopping is compatibility with the phone that the senior uses. In some cases, a particular smartwatch may only be compatible with a certain brand of phone. For example, the Apple Watch only works with an Apple iPhone, and while some Android Smartwatches, including some Samsung Galaxy Watch models, may work on an iPhone, they tend to work better with Android phones.
